The creative world has always been shaped by new tools, from the paintbrush to Photoshop, but the latest addition is less about pixels and more about words. Enter the “prompt designer”, a role born out of AI tools like MidJourney and ChatGPT, where carefully crafted instructions can turn into polished visuals, clever copy, or fully fleshed-out concepts in seconds. Far from being a passing fad, prompt design is quickly becoming a skill that separates amateurs from professionals, giving creatives a new way to spark ideas, move faster, and explore possibilities that were once out of reach.

AI Hallucinations: The Silent Risk Marketers Cannot Ignore

By |2025-09-29T11:41:13+02:00September 29th, 2025|Branding, Branding News, Digital Marketing, Web Design|

Generative AI has transformed marketing with speed and efficiency, but it is not foolproof. One of the biggest risks is AI hallucinations, where content sounds polished but is factually wrong or completely made up. For marketers, these errors can erode trust, damage reputations, and even cause legal headaches. In this article, we unpack what hallucinations are, why they matter, how to spot them, and practical steps to keep them from slipping into your content.
